FIS: Financial Investor Scheme, this is for high net-worth persons
Foreign Artistic Talent Scheme: This scheme is designed purposefully for top-class people of particular arts
GIP: Global Investor Program, investors and entrepreneur can take advantage with this scheme
PTS: Professional/Technical Personnel and Skilled Workers Scheme, this is for people who have employment pass, already working in Singapore

Obviously, after achieving success or winning your objectives you will be entitled for the following benefits:Healthcare facility: In Singapore, the healthcare system consists of private and public healthcare. A permanent resident of Singapore has to pay subsidized fee at public hospitals and government outpatient clinics as compare to a non-resident. Moreover, being a PR you also become eligible for national insurance scheme and medical savings benefits.
Schooling for children: According to the education system of Singapore Permanent Resident Students have to pay subsidized fee in public schools in contrast to foreign students. However, keep in mind even if your parents have a PR status and you do not have it, you will be regarded as a foreigner.
Emigrants, according to Residential Property Act of Singapore, can have non-restricted properties such as condominium apartments. Emigrants and Permanent Residents who are interested to buy restricted properties like landed properties; vacant land etc will need the permission of Singapore Land Authority. However, a permanent resident has a right to buy from resale market but emigrants do not have this permission.
